DIRECTOR OF FIELD MARKETING

Responsibilities
Build marketing programs in partnership with Operators, support teams, and VP of Marketing to ensure continued engagement from students, clients, and communities.
Show off influencing skills and make a difference through others who may not report directly to you.
Be the go-to person for training and supporting operators and on-site Marketing Specialists.
Develop and maintain marketing & merchandising tools, including diagrams and pictures.
Conduct marketing audits to ensure front-of-house operations are outstanding.
Build implementation tools, materials, modules, and procedures.
Collaborate with Culinary and Nutrition teams to develop amazing programs.
Dive into focus groups and surveys to uncover key market insights.
Work closely with strategic accounts, addressing their needs and turning risks into opportunities.
Collect data and report on return on investment and key performance metrics.

Required
7+ years experience in marketing and/or training, preferably in foodservice, or in operations/culinary roles with demonstrated ability to market programs, merchandise, and build outstanding customer experiences.
Bachelor's degree from an accredited college or equivalent experience in multi-unit foodservice or hospitality management in lieu of degree
Excellent written and verbal communication skills
Ability to Set priorities and stay organized in a changing environment
Project management skills are gold. If you can steer implementation and bring about positive outcomes through teamwork, you're our hero.
Demonstrated ability to lead implementation and produce positive outcomes by working through teams
Word, Excel, Outlook, Forms and especially PowerPoint
Extensive travel (50%)
